CranioSacral Therapy (CST) helps spine and back health by addressing fascial restrictions, which are tight connective tissues surrounding the spine, and improving the circulation of cerebrospinal fluid. By releasing these restrictions and enhancing fluid flow, CST can relieve tension, reduce pain, and improve overall spinal alignment and function.
How CST can help with Spine and Back Health:
Fascial Release:
CST utilizes gentle touch to release tension in the fascia, a network of connective tissues that envelops muscles, bones, and organs. When the fascia around the spine becomes restricted, it can lead to pain, limited mobility, and postural imbalances. CST aims to release these restrictions, improving spinal mobility and reducing pain.
Cerebrospinal Fluid Circulation:
CST works by enhancing the circulation of cerebrospinal fluid (CSF), which surrounds the brain and spinal cord. This fluid plays a crucial role in transporting nutrients and waste products. The healthy circulation of CSF is essential for proper nervous system function. By improving CSF circulation, CST can reduce inflammation, improve nerve function, and alleviate pain associated with spine and back problems.
Nervous System Regulation:
CST can also help calm the nervous system, particularly the sympathetic nervous system, which is responsible for the "fight-or-flight" response. By reducing tension and promoting relaxation, CST can help reduce the stress that contributes to back pain and other spinal issues.
Improved Posture and Alignment:
By addressing fascial restrictions and improving spinal alignment, CST can help improve posture and promote better body mechanics. This can lead to reduced strain on the spine and improved overall well-being.
Pain Relief:
By releasing tension in the fascia and improving nervous system function, CST can help alleviate the pain associated with a variety of spinal conditions, including chronic neck and back pain, fibromyalgia, and sciatica.
